I figure a day or two at the most now (about to pass out for some much-needed sleep, then back to drawing all night). :dr_default:[h1]New Modes[/h1] The main game has become a Story Mode split into multiple levels that keep carrying your score forward, with different backgrounds and increasingly harder enemies (I'm adding art details/variations (spikes on armor and that kind of thing) for each difficulty level of the units instead of just quickly color swapping them, that's why it's taking longer to draw) so a full run-through should feel more like a full game finally lol There's Time Trial mode (it won't end until your combo ends and starts calculating, so if you're good and can keep your combo going you can keep racking up points past the default time limit) and Endless mode (no textboxes popping up and when you get through the first set of all the enemies, the next level of harder enemies start spawning, etc until all of the enemies are the hardest difficulty and you survive as long as you can), along with Leaderboards for Time Trial and Endless Mode. :dr_angry:[h1]Hunger Meter Tweaks[/h1] I've revamped the Hunger Meter's math a bit because watching people's videos I felt like when things got hectic death was seemingly coming out of nowhere blindsiding people unfairly (going from full health to dead in 0.1 seconds because by sheer timing fluke a huge group of enemies would all land their attack on the same frame) so that's been smoothed out and feels way more fair.
